Tyrosine is an amino acid precursor to catecholamine production. Catecholamine production increases cardiac output, glucose release, ventilatory rate, and even muscle strength. Therefore, many have proposed that supplementing with tyrosine may improve exercise performance. While this hasn’t been definitively shown in research, tyrosine may improve cognitive performance during periods of high stress or exhaustion. If you feel that your mental focus is lacking towards the end of a tough workout, tyrosine may be worth trying. However, most bodybuilders will likely not benefit from tyrosine supplementation.
